• JavaScript对象练习


    <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d">
    <html>
        <head>
            <meta http-equiv="Content-Type" content="text/html; charset=GBK">
            <title>Untitled Document</title>
        </head>
        <body>
            <script type="text/javascript" src="jstool.js"></script>
            <script type="text/javascript">
                /*function person(){
                    print("person run");
                }
                var  p=new person();
                p.name="zhansan";
                p.age=33;
                p.show=function(){
                    print("__"+this.name+"__"+this.age);
                }
                p.show();
                */
                
            /*    function person(name,age){
                    this.name=name;
                    this.age=age;
                     this.getname=function(){
                        return this.name;
                    }
                }
                var p=new person("zhansan",33);
                print(p.getname());
            */
            
            var pp={
                "name":"zhansan","age":33,
                "getname":function(){
                    return this.name;
                }
            }
            print(pp.name);
            //对象成员有两种方式
            print(pp["age"]+":"+pp.name);
            
            var map={
                3:"xiaoqiang",4:"xiaozhang",5:"xiaoeri"
            }
            var vall=getkey(3);
            print(vall);
            function getkey(key){
                return    map[key];
            }
            var myobj={
                myname:"xiaoming",myage:44
            }
            print(myobj.myname+"__"+myobj.myage+"_"+myobj["myage"]);
            var myobj1={
                "myname":"xiaoming","myage":44
            }
            var myobj2={
                myarray:[3,4,2,4,22,34,34]
            }
            print(myobj2.myarray[3]);
            var mymap={
                names:[{name1:"战三"},{maname:"小花"}]
            }
            print(mymap.names[0].name1);
            </script>
        </body>
    </html>
  • 相关阅读:
    JavaScript学习笔记之数组(一)
    Ajax与CORS通信
    JSONP跨域
    JavaScript原型与原型链
    CSS布局套路
    爱奇艺的自制节目
    2019.3.6错误经验
    Kickdown UVA
    ASP.NET Web
    C# Windows
  • 原文地址:https://www.cnblogs.com/kedoudejingshen/p/2749776.html
Copyright © 2020-2023  润新知